5 Signs That You Should Consider Changing Your 3pl Partner

In any business relationship, there’s only so long that you can ignore that nagging feeling that something’s not right. And when it’s your third-party logistics partner you’re concerned about, it’s important that you address the problem sooner rather than later. After all, your customers and your brand reputation are at stake if things go wrong. So, when is it time to change 3pl?

To Change, Or Not To Change 3pl?

Once a brand has made the decision to outsource their fulfilment – with everything that entails – there’s a natural wariness when it comes to switching. If you’re unhappy with your current 3pl, it may be tempting to decide ‘better the devil you know’ rather than taking action. Except that doing nothing can leave you weakened as a brand, with an order fulfilment partner that has the power to lose you profits, customers and market momentum.

Is It Time To Change 3pl? 5 Ways to Know

In our experience, at Prolog Fulfilment, there are 5 key questions that brands need to ask themselves, when facing the dilemma of whether or not to change their 3pl. It may not be an easy process to put yourself through, but once you have answered each of these questions you should be able to answer the big one: Is it time to change 3pl?

1. Is Your Customer Service Constantly Improving?

The bottom line for any fulfilment provider is to offer customer service excellence. This means that the right order arrives, on time, and in full. If this is not the case, your brand reputation is being harmed.

Beyond the bottom line, though, a 3pl should be consistently looking for, and offering ways to further improve on your customer service. This is integral to your competitiveness and success. Without it your brand is stalling.

2. Is Peak a Time of Peril?

Every brand looks forward to those moments in the year when goods are flying off the warehouse shelves. Christmas and Valentines are the ones you can predict, but there’s also the moments that take you by surprise, when your product catches the eye of an Instagram influencer and suddenly everyone wants it.

Your 3pl needs to be able to deal with the peaks they know are coming, and those they don’t. Otherwise, opportunities are being wasted and your brand is losing potential profits.

3. Is Product Personalisation on Offer?

The majority of customers – when asked – say that they want their online shopping experience to be personalised. So, what is your 3pl offering to help you achieve a greater degree of fulfilment personalisation? Whether its personalised promotions, kitting, or personalising your products to provide a unique offering to your customers.

3pls work across a range of sectors and have the knowledge and experience to know what your customers would value – they need to make those improvements

4. Is Innovation High on Their Agenda?

The past two years have been a boom time for eCommerce, but how hungry is your 3pl for ongoing innovation? As a fairly young industry eCommerce fulfilment is moving fast. The industry leaders have plans in place to achieve net zero, are ready to invest in order to improve processes, and are aware of the trends that are currently driving eCommerce.

When was the last time your 3pl talked to you about their vision for the next few years, or their sustainability strategy?

To Change, Or Not To Change 3pl

5. Do They Behave Like Partners?

3pls are more than providers, they’re partners in the growth and success of your business. If they’re behaving more like a provider than a partner, then they’re not fulfilling their part of the bargain. A partner doesn’t stop talking to you once you’re onboarded. They don’t make you wait for resolution to a problem you’re experiencing. And they don’t ignore requests for reviews or reports.

A partner remains actively in dialogue with you throughout onboarding and beyond. They offer supply chain consultation, and regularly review your ongoing relationship.
